Gufo Font

Telecom and IT-oriented icon font.


Documentation: https://docs.gufolabs.com/gufo_font/

Source Code: https://github.com/gufolabs/gufo_font/


NPM Version License License: CC BY-ND 4.0 Sponsors

Gufo Font is a specialized icon font designed for telecom and IT applications. In addition to common UI icons, it includes a wide range of symbols useful for diagrams, network maps, and visualizing complex systems. It also features icons inspired by popular vendor stencil packs, redrawed for visual consistency.

Gufo Font is a color font built with COLR/CPAL technology, offering numerous benefits:

  • High-quality, scalable graphics
  • Perfect-square glyphs for flawless positioning on maps and charts
  • Consistent design across all icons
  • Smooth and intuitive user experience
  • Broad browser support
  • Compatibility with desktop and graphic design applications
  • Ultra-fast rendering compared to SVG
  • Easy visualization of node statuses
  • Industry-standard symbols
  • Vendor-specific icon sets, thoughroughly curated for consistent look

License

Source files / scripts

All source files, scripts, and tools (excluding compiled fonts) are licensed under the BSD 3-Clause License.
You are free to use, modify, and redistribute these files. Contributions are welcome, but official font binaries are generated only by Gufo Labs.

Compiled fonts (woff2)

Official compiled fonts in webfonts/ are licensed under CC BY-ND 4.0.

  • Free to use, including commercially
  • Modifications or redistribution of modified fonts are not allowed

This ensures all official releases are centralized and controlled.

On Gufo Stack

This product is a part of Gufo Stack - the collaborative effort led by Gufo Labs. Our goal is to create a robust and flexible set of tools to create network management software and automate routine administration tasks.

To do this, we extract the key technologies that have proven themselves in the NOC and bring them as separate packages. Then we work on API, performance tuning, documentation, and testing. The NOC uses the final result as the external dependencies.

Gufo Stack makes the NOC better, and this is our primary task. But other products can benefit from Gufo Stack too. So we believe that our effort will make the other network management products better.
